We consider a Horava theory that has a consistent structure of constraints and propagates two physical degrees of freedom.
- The Lagrangian includes the terms of Blas, Pujolas and Sibiryakov.
- The theory can be obtained from the general Horava's formulation by setting lambda = 1/3.
- This value of lambda is protected in the quantum formulation of the theory by the presence of a constraint.
